Doomed Queens: Royal Women Who Met Bad Ends, From Cleopatra to Princess Di by Kris Waldherr
Published 2008
176 Pages
ISBN: 9780767928991
I own several books about royal death. Out of all of them, hands down, this one is the funniest. I'll go as far as saying that this is one of the best books in my collection.
In 2009 I wrote a review for Doomed Queens, so I won't spoil it for you. Suffice to say that anyone who can take a macabre topic and combine it with gleeful humor, deserves some type of award in the best book about royal death category.
Heads off!..err hats off..to you Ms Waldherr!
